Sec. 460k-1. Acquisition of lands for recreational development; 
        funds
        
    The Secretary is authorized to acquire areas of land, or interests 
therein, which are suitable for--
        (1) incidental fish and wildlife-oriented recreational 
    development,
        (2) the protection of natural resources,
        (3) the conservation of endangered species or threatened species 
    listed by the Secretary pursuant to section 1533 of this title, or
        (4) carrying out two or more of the purposes set forth in 
    paragraphs (1) through (3) of this section, and are adjacent to, or 
    within, the said conservation areas, except that the acquisition of 
    any land or interest therein pursuant to this section shall be 
    accomplished only with such funds as may be appropriated therefor by 
    the Congress or donated for such purposes, but such property shall 
    not be acquired with funds obtained from the sale of Federal 
    migratory bird hunting stamps.

Lands acquired pursuant to this section shall become a part of the 
particular conservation area to which they are adjacent.

(Pub. L. 87-714, Sec. 2, Sept. 28, 1962, 76 Stat. 653; Pub. L. 92-534, 
Oct. 23, 1972, 86 Stat. 1063; Pub. L. 93-205, Sec. 13(d), Dec. 28, 1973, 
87 Stat. 902.)


                               Amendments

    1973--Pub. L. 93-205 inserted references to the acquisition of 
interest in land the conservation of endangered species or threatened 
species listed by the Secretary pursuant to section 1533 of this title.
    1972--Pub. L. 92-534 substituted provisions authorizing the 
Secretary to acquire lands suitable for fish and wildlife oriented 
recreational development, or for the protection of natural resources and 
adjacent to conservation areas, for provisions authorizing the Secretary 
to acquire limited areas of land for recreational development adjacent 
to conservation areas in existence or approved by the Migratory Bird 
Conservation Commission as of September 28, 1962.


                    Effective Date of 1973 Amendment

    Amendment by Pub. L. 93-205 effective Dec. 28, 1973, see section 16 
of Pub. L. 93-205, set out as a note under section 1531 of this title.
